Miniature rose(Rosa hybrida)is one of the most extensively cultivated ornamental plants worldwide,and the double-flower traits strongly enhance its aesthetic value.However,the regulatory mechanisms underlying petal number variation remain unclear.In this study,we conducted comparative transcriptomic analysis of floral buds in miniature rose'Eclair'and its bud sport‘Konkyusare,'which have increased petaloid stamens.We identified a crucial differentially expressed gene,RhDAO1,encoding an auxin-catabolising dioxygenase.RhDAO1 expression was significantly higher during early floral bud development in'Eclair'than in'Konkyusare'and showed an inverse correlation with indole-3-acetic acid(IAA)accumulation.Transient overexpression of RhDAO1 in rose petals resulted in a significant reduction in the levels of IAA and its catabolite IAA-Asp.RhDAO1 silencing in rose plants increased petaloid stamens while reducing normal stamen count.Furthermore,RhDAO1 significantly altered the expression patterns of key floral organ identity genes,including RhAP2,RhAG,RhSHP1,and auxin signalling components.In situ hybridisation and IAA immunolocalisation showed that RhDAO1transcripts colocalised with IAA accumulation maxima in developing floral organ primordia,and silenced buds exhibited elevated endogenous IAA.Exogenous IAA treatment partially mimicked the RhDAO1-silenced phenotype by promoting stamen-to-petal conversion in‘Eclair'.Meanwhile,the auxin transport inhibitor N-1-naphthylphthalamic acid(NPA)treatment decreased petal number in'Konkyusare'.Collectively,our results demonstrate that Rh DAO1 fine-tunes floral organ identity through spatiotemporal regulation of auxin homeostasis and transcriptional control of floral organ identity genes,providing insights for refining double-flower traits in rose breeding programmes. 展开更多

Coloration in rose(Rosa hybrida) petals is primarily determined by anthocyanin accumulation in vacuoles, and vacuolar acidification plays a central role in controlling the accumulation of this pigment. Nevertheless, the regulatory interplay between anthocyanin accumulation and tissue acidification processes remains somewhat unclear. The present study characterized an activator Rh MYB114 and a repressor Rh MYB16,which functioned synergistically in anthocyanin accumulation and tissue acidification in rose. Transforming tobacco and roses by overexpression, the introduction of Rh MYB114 resulted in an increase in anthocyanin levels and a noticeable decrease in p H in the petal cells of both rose and tobacco, whereas Rh MYB16 introduction led to inverse effects. To further clarify the underlying the regulatory mechanisms, the yeast two-hybrid(Y2H), bimolecular fluorescence complementation(Bi FC) and dual-luciferase(LUC) were employed. The results showed that Rh MYB16 competed with Rh MYB114, bound to Rhb HLH3 or Rhb HLH33, and inhibited its ability to induce the expression of genes related to anthocyanin biosynthesis and acidification. Our findings revealed a feedback mechanism for the regulation of anthocyanin synthesis and tissue acidification involving Rh MYB114, which stimulated the transcriptional expression of Rh MYB16, whose encoded protein Rh MYB16, in turn, negatively regulated the transcriptional expression of Rh MYB114. Therefore, this study underscores the pivotal roles of the Rh MYB114-Rh MYB16 loop in regulating anthocyanin synthesis and tissue acidification, offering insights into metabolic manipulation to enhance the aesthetic appeal of roses. 展开更多

目的:评估第三代测序(TGS)技术在临床检测神经元核内包涵体病(NIID)NOTCH2NLC基因GGC重复序列中的优势。方法:收集2017年1月至2023年12月于徐州医科大学附属医院神经内科确诊的NIID患者(确诊组,n=10)、临床疑似但未确诊者(疑似组,n=10)... 目的:评估第三代测序(TGS)技术在临床检测神经元核内包涵体病(NIID)NOTCH2NLC基因GGC重复序列中的优势。方法:收集2017年1月至2023年12月于徐州医科大学附属医院神经内科确诊的NIID患者(确诊组,n=10)、临床疑似但未确诊者(疑似组,n=10)及健康对照者(对照组,n=10)的外周血样本。采用长距离PCR(LR-PCR)及重复引物PCR(RP-PCR)扩增NOTCH2NLC基因GGC重复序列,通过毛细管电泳(CE)进行初筛,阳性样本进一步采用TGS技术(PacBio Sequel IIe平台)验证,并对比两种方法的重复序列检测能力。结果:确诊组10例样本经CE复测均检出GGC重复序列,其中2例重复数>110的样本无法确定GGC重复数量;疑似组NIID的10例样本中,CE检出4例存在可疑重复序列(其中2例重复数>110无法定量)。TGS对14例CE阳性样本均给出精确重复数,包括CE未能定量的4例高重复样本。两种方法均未提示假阳性和假阴性的状况。结论:TGS能够有效克服CE在NIID高重复序列定量中的技术局限,实现精准定量并解析序列结构,为NIID的分子分型与精准诊疗提供更可靠的技术支持。 展开更多

Background:Shenyankangfu Tablet(SYKFT)is a Chinese patent medicine that has been used widely to decrease proteinuria and the progression of chronic kidney disease.Objective:This trial compared the efficacy and safety of SYKFT,for the control of proteinuria in primary glomerulonephritis patients,against the standard drug,losartan potassium.Design,setting,participants and intervention:This was a multicenter,double-blind,randomized,controlled clinical trial.Primary glomerulonephritis patients,aged 18-70 years,with blood pressure≤140/90 mmHg,estimated glomerular filtration rate(eGFR)>45 mL/min per 1.73 ㎡,and 24-hour proteinuria level of 0.5-3.0 g,were recruited in 41 hospitals across 19 provinces in China and were randomly divided into five groups:SYKFT,losartan potassium 50 mg or 100 mg,SYKFT plus losartan potassium 50 mg or 100 mg.Main outcome measu res:The primary outcome was change in the 24-hour proteinuria level,after 48 weeks of treatment.Results:A total of 735 participants were enrolled.The percent decline of urine protein quantification in the SYKFT group after 48 weeks was 8.78%±2.56%(P=0.006)more than that in the losartan 50 mg group,which was 0.51%±2.54%(P=1.000)less than that in the losartan 100 mg group.Compared with the losartan potassium 50 mg group,the SYKFT plus losartan potassium 50 mg group had a 13.39%±2.49%(P<0.001)greater reduction in urine protein level.Compared with the losartan potassium 100 mg group,the SYKFT plus losartan potassium 100 mg group had a 9.77%±2.52%(P=0.001)greater reduction in urine protein.With a superiority threshold of 15%,neither was statistically significant.eGFR,serum creatinine and serum albumin from the baseline did not change statistically significant.The average change in TCM syndrome score between the patients who took SYKFT(-3.00[-6.00,-2.00])and who did not take SYKFT(-2.00[-5.00,0])was statistically significant(P=0.003).No obvious adverse reactions were observed in any group.Conclusion:SYKFT decreased the proteinuria and improved the TCM syndrome scores of primary glomerulonephritis patients,with no change in the rate of decrease in the eGFR.SYKFT plus losartan potassium therapy decreased proteinuria more than losartan potassium therapy alone.Trial registration number:NCT02063100 on ClinicalTrials.gov. 展开更多

OBJECTIVE: To justify the clinical use of Traditional Chinese Medicine(TCM) in the treatment of influenza.METHODS: MEDLINE, EMBASE, Chinese Biomedical Literature Database, China National Knowledge Infrastructure Database, China Science and Technology Journal Database, Wanfang Database and the Cochrane Database of Systematic Reviews were searched from thedate of inception until January 1,2013, for the literature on treatment of influenza with TCM.RESULTS: A total of 7 randomized controlled trials were identified and reviewed. Of these trials, 2 compared a(modified) prescription of TCM with oseltamivir and 5 compared a patent traditional Chinese drug with oseltamivir. Based on the Meta-analysis,compared to oseltamivir, the(modified) prescription had similar effect in defervescence [WMD=5.66, 95% CI(﹣32.02, 43.35), P=0.77] and viral shedding [WMD=﹣ 6.21, 95% CI(﹣84.19, 71.76), P=0.88], and the patent traditional Chinese drug also had similar effect in viral shedding [WMD=﹣ 0.24,95% CI(﹣4.79, 4.31), P=0.92] but more effective in defervescence [WMD=﹣4.65, 95%CI(﹣8.91, ﹣0.38),P=0.03].CONCLUSION: TCM has potential positive effects in the treatment of influenza. 展开更多

Distributed Denial of Service(DDoS)attacks is always one of the major problems for service providers.Using blockchain to detect DDoS attacks is one of the current popular methods.However,the problems of high time overhead and cost exist in the most of the blockchain methods for detecting DDoS attacks.This paper proposes a blockchain-based collaborative detection method for DDoS attacks.First,the trained DDoS attack detection model is encrypted by the Intel Software Guard Extensions(SGX),which provides high security for uploading the DDoS attack detection model to the blockchain.Secondly,the service provider uploads the encrypted model to Inter Planetary File System(IPFS)and then a corresponding Content-ID(CID)is generated by IPFS which greatly saves the cost of uploading encrypted models to the blockchain.In addition,due to the small amount of model data,the time cost of uploading the DDoS attack detection model is greatly reduced.Finally,through the blockchain and smart contracts,the CID is distributed to other service providers,who can use the CID to download the corresponding DDoS attack detection model from IPFS.Blockchain provides a decentralized,trusted and tamper-proof environment for service providers.Besides,smart contracts and IPFS greatly improve the distribution efficiency of the model,while the distribution of CID greatly improves the efficiency of the transmission on the blockchain.In this way,the purpose of collaborative detection can be achieved,and the time cost of transmission on blockchain and IPFS can be considerably saved.We designed a blockchain-based DDoS attack collaborative detection framework to improve the data transmission efficiency on the blockchain,and use IPFS to greatly reduce the cost of the distribution model.In the experiment,compared with most blockchain-based method for DDoS attack detection,the proposed model using blockchain distribution shows the advantages of low cost and latency.The remote authentication mechanism of Intel SGX provides high security and integrity,and ensures the availability of distributed models. 展开更多

With the increasing number of smart devices and the development of machine learning technology,the value of users’personal data is becoming more and more important.Based on the premise of protecting users’personal privacy data,federated learning(FL)uses data stored on edge devices to realize training tasks by contributing training model parameters without revealing the original data.However,since FL can still leak the user’s original data by exchanging gradient information.The existing privacy protection strategy will increase the uplink time due to encryption measures.It is a huge challenge in terms of communication.When there are a large number of devices,the privacy protection cost of the system is higher.Based on these issues,we propose a privacy-preserving scheme of user-based group collaborative federated learning(GrCol-PPFL).Our scheme primarily divides participants into several groups and each group communicates in a chained transmission mechanism.All groups work in parallel at the same time.The server distributes a random parameter with the same dimension as the model parameter for each participant as a mask for the model parameter.We use the public datasets of modified national institute of standards and technology database(MNIST)to test the model accuracy.The experimental results show that GrCol-PPFL not only ensures the accuracy of themodel,but also ensures the security of the user’s original data when users collude with each other.Finally,through numerical experiments,we show that by changing the number of groups,we can find the optimal number of groups that reduces the uplink consumption time. 展开更多

BACKGROUND The risk of early mortality of patients who start dialysis urgently is high;however,in patients with diabetes undergoing urgent-start peritoneal dialysis(USPD),the risk of,and risk factors for,early mortality are unknown.AIM To identify risk factors for mortality during high-risk periods in patients with diabetes undergoing USPD.METHODS This retrospective cohort study enrolled 568 patients with diabetes,aged≥18 years,who underwent USPD at one of five Chinese centers between 2013 and 2019.We divided the follow-up period into two survival phases:The first 6 mo of USPD therapy and the months thereafter.We compared demographic and baseline clinical data of living and deceased patients during each period.Kaplan-Meier survival curves were generated for all-cause mortality according to the New York Heart Association(NYHA)classification.A multivariate Cox proportional hazard regression model was used to identify risk factors for mortality within the first 6 mo and after 6 mo of USPD.RESULTS Forty-one patients died within the first 6 mo,accounting for the highest proportion of mortalities(26.62%)during the entire follow-up period.Cardiovascular disease was the leading cause of mortality within 6 mo(26.83%)and after 6 mo(31.86%).The risk of mortality not only within the first 6 mo but also after the first 6 mo was higher for patients with obvious baseline heart failure symptoms than for those with mild or no heart failure symptoms.Independent risk factors for mortality within the first 6 mo were advanced age hazard ratio(HR:1.908;95%CI:1.400-2.600;P<0.001),lower baseline serum creatinine level(HR:0.727;95%CI:0.614-0.860;P<0.001),higher baseline serum phosphorus level(HR:3.162;95%CI:1.848-5.409;P<0.001),and baseline NYHA class III-IV(HR:2.148;95%CI:1.063-4.340;P=0.033).Independent risk factors for mortality after 6 mo were advanced age(HR:1.246;95%CI:1.033-1.504;P=0.022)and baseline NYHA class III-IV(HR:2.015;95%CI:1.298-3.130;P=0.002).CONCLUSION To reduce the risk of mortality within the first 6 mo of USPD in patients with diabetes,controlling the serum phosphorus level and improving cardiac function are recommended。 展开更多

This paper is concerned with the problem of odor source localization using multi-robot system.A learning particle swarm optimization algorithm,which can coordinate a multi-robot system to locate the odor source,is proposed.First,in order to develop the proposed algorithm,a source probability map for a robot is built and updated by using concentration magnitude information,wind information,and swarm information.Based on the source probability map,the new position of the robot can be generated.Second,a distributed coordination architecture,by which the proposed algorithm can run on the multi-robot system,is designed.Specifically,the proposed algorithm is used on the group level to generate a new position for the robot.A consensus algorithm is then adopted on the robot level in order to control the robot to move from the current position to the new position.Finally,the effectiveness of the proposed algorithm is illustrated for the odor source localization problem. 展开更多

Due to small size and high occult,metacarpophalangeal fracturediagnosis displays a low accuracy in terms of fracture detection and locationin X-ray images.To efficiently detect metacarpophalangeal fractures on Xrayimages as the second opinion for radiologists,we proposed a novel onestageneural network namedMPFracNet based onRetinaNet.InMPFracNet,a deformable bottleneck block(DBB)was integrated into the bottleneckto better adapt to the geometric variation of the fractures.Furthermore,an integrated feature fusion module(IFFM)was employed to obtain morein-depth semantic and shallow detail features.Specifically,Focal Loss andBalanced L1 Loss were introduced to respectively attenuate the imbalancebetween positive and negative classes and the imbalance between detectionand location tasks.We assessed the proposed model on the test set andachieved an AP of 80.4%for the metacarpophalangeal fracture detection.To estimate the detection performance for fractures with different difficulties,the proposed model was tested on the subsets of metacarpal,phalangeal andtiny fracture test sets and achieved APs of 82.7%,78.5%and 74.9%,respectively.Our proposed framework has state-of-the-art performance for detectingmetacarpophalangeal fractures,which has a strong potential application valuein practical clinical environments. 展开更多

BACKGROUND The number of end-stage renal disease patients with diabetes mellitus(DM)who are undergoing peritoneal dialysis is increasing.Peritoneal dialysis-associated peritonitis(PDAP)is a serious complication of peritoneal dialysis leading to technical failure and increased mortality in patients undergoing peritoneal dialysis.The profile of clinical symptoms,distribution of pathogenic organisms,and response of PDAP to medical management in the subset of end-stage renal disease patients with DM have not been reported previously.Discrepant results have been found in long-term prognostic outcomes of PDAP in patients with DM.We inferred that DM is associated with bad outcomes in PDAP patients.AIM To compare the clinical features and outcomes of PDAP between patients with DM and those without.METHODS In this multicenter retrospective cohort study,we enrolled patients who had at least one episode of PDAP during the study period.The patients were followed for a median of 31.1 mo.They were divided into a DM group and a non-DM group.Clinical features,therapeutic outcomes,and long-term prognostic outcomes were compared between the two groups.Risk factors associated with therapeutic outcomes of PDAP were analyzed using multivariable logistic regression.A Cox proportional hazards model was constructed to examine the influence of DM on patient survival and incidence of technical failure.RESULTS Overall,373 episodes occurred in the DM group(n=214)and 692 episodes occurred in the non-DM group(n=395).The rates of abdominal pain and fever were similar in the two groups(P>0.05).The DM group had more infections with coagulase-negative Staphylococcus and less infections with Escherichia coli(E.coli)as compared to the non-DM group(P0.05).Patients in the DM group were older and had a higher burden of cardiovascular disease,with lower level of serum albumin,but a higher estimated glomerular filtration rate(P0.05).CONCLUSION PDAP patients with diabetes have similar symptomology and are predisposed to coagulase-negative Staphylococcus but not E.coli infection compared those without.Diabetes is associated with higher all-cause mortality but not therapeutic outcomes of PDAP. 展开更多

Novel applications of nanotechnology may lead to the release of engineered nanoparticles(ENPs), which result in concerns over their potential environmental hazardous impact. It is essential for the research workers to be able to quantitatively characterise ENPs in the environment and subsequently to assist the risk assessment of the ENPs. This study hence explored the application of nanoparticle tracking system(NTA) to quantitatively describe the behaviour of the ENPs in natural sediment-water systems. The NTA allows the measurement of both particle number concentration(PNC) and particle size distribution(PSD) of the ENPs. The developed NTA method was applied to a range of gold and magnetite ENPs with a selection of surface properties. The results showed that the positively-charged ENPs interacted more strongly with the sediment than neutral and negatively-charged ENPs. It was also found that the citrate coated Au ENPs had a higher distribution percentage(53%) than 11-mercaptoundecanoic acid coated Au ENPs(20%) and citrate coated magnetite ENPs(21%). The principles of the electrostatic interactions between hard(and soft) acids and bases(HSAB) are used to explain such behaviours; the hard base coating(i.e. citrate ions) will interact more strongly with hard acid(i.e. magnetite) than soft acid(i.e. gold).The results indicate that NTA is a complementary method to existing approaches to characterise the fate and behaviour of ENPs in natural sediment. 展开更多

Genomic prediction(GP)in plant breeding has the potential to predict and identify the best-performing hybrids based on the genotypes of their parental lines.In a GP experiment,34 elite inbred lines were selected to make 285 single-cross hybrids in a partial-diallel cross design.These lines represented a mini-core collection of Chinese maize germplasm and comprised 18 inbred lines from the Stiff Stalk heterotic group and 16 inbred lines from the Non-Stiff Stalk heterotic group.The parents were genotyped by sequencing and the 285 hybrids were phenotyped for nine yield and yield-related traits at two locations in the summer sowing area(SUS)and three locations in the spring sowing area(SPS)in the main maizeproducing regions of China.Multiple GP models were employed to assess the accuracy of trait prediction in the hybrids.By ten-fold cross-validation,the prediction accuracies of yield performance of the hybrids estimated by the genomic best linear unbiased prediction(GBLUP)model in SUS and SPS were 0.51 and 0.46,respectively.The prediction accuracies of the remaining yield-related traits estimated with GBLUP ranged from 0.49 to 0.86 and from 0.53 to 0.89 in SUS and SPS,respectively.When additive,dominance,epistasis effects,genotype-by-environment interaction,and multi-trait effects were incorporated into the prediction model,the prediction accuracy of hybrid yield performance was improved.The ratio of training to testing population and size of training population optimal for yield prediction were determined.Multiple prediction models can improve prediction accuracy in hybrid breeding. 展开更多

Morphological changes within the porous architecture of laboratory scale zero valent iron (ZVI) permeable reactive barriers (PRBs), after exposure to different groundwater conditions, have been quantified experimentally for different ZVI/sand ratios (10%, 50% and 100%, W/W) with the aim of inferring porosity changes in field barriers. Column studies were conducted to simulate interaction with different water chemistries, a synthetic groundwater, acidic drainage and deionised (DI) water as control. Morphological changes, in terms of pore size and distribution, were measured using X-ray computed tomography (CT). CT image analysis revealed significant morphological changes in columns treated with different water chemistries. For example, 100% ZVI (W/W) columns had a higher frequency of small pores (0.6 mm) was observed in ZVI grains reacted with typical groundwater, resulting in a porosity of 27%, compared to 32% when exposed to DI water. In comparison, ZVI grains treated with the acidic drainage had higher porosity (44%) and larger average pore size (2.8 mm). 10% ZVI PRB barrier material had the highest mean porosity (56%) after exposure to any water chemistry whilst 100% ZVI (W/W) columns always had the lowest (34%) with the 50% ZVI (W/W) in between (40%). These results agree with previously published PRB field data and simultaneously conducted geochemical monitoring and mass balance calculation, indicating that both the geochemical and hydraulic environment of the PRB play an important role in determining barrier lifespan. This study suggests that X-ray CT image analysis is a powerful tool for studying the detailed inter pores between ZVI grains within PRBs. 展开更多

Today, along with the prevalent use of portable equipment, wireless, and other battery powered systems, the demand for amplifiers with a high gain-bandwidth product(GBW), slew rate(SR), and at the same time very low static power dissipation is growing. In this work, an operational transconductance amplifier(OTA) with an enhanced SR is proposed. By inserting a sensing resistor in the input port of the current mirror in the OTA, the voltage drop across the resistor is converted into an output current containing a term in proportion to the square of the voltage, and then the SR of the proposed OTA is significantly enhanced and the current dissipation can be reduced. The proposed OTA is designed and simulated with a 0.5μm complementary metal oxide semiconductor(CMOS) process. The simulation results show that the SR is 4.54V/μs, increased by 8.25 times than that of the conventional design, while the current dissipation is only 87.3%. 展开更多

With the increase of the clock frequency and silicon integration, power aware computing has become a critical concern in the design of the embedded processor and system-on-chip (SoC). Dynamic voltage scaling (DVS) is an effective method for low-power designs. However, traditional DVS methods have two deficiencies. First, they have a conservative safety margin which is not necessary for most of the time. Second, they are exclusively concerned with the critical stage and ignore the significant potential free slack time of the noncritical stage. These factors lead to a large amount of power waste. In this paper, a novel pipeline structure with ultra-low power consumption is proposed. It cuts off the safety margin and takes use of the noncritical stages at the same time. A prototype pipeline is designed in 0.13 μm technology and analyzed. The result shows that a large amount of energy can be saved by using this structure. Compared with the fixed voltage case, 50% of the energy can be saved, and with respect to the traditional adaptive voltage scaling design, 37.8% of the energy can be saved. 展开更多

On the other hand, the c... Digital circuits operating in the sub-threshold regime consume the least energy. The strict energy constraints are desired in the applications which work at the lowest possible supply voltage. On the other hand, the conventional design flow utilizes the technology library provided by the foundry with a fixed voltage boundary, which causes problems when the supply scales down to the sub-threshold regime. In this paper, we present a design methodology to characterize the existing cell library with Liberty NCX to facilitate the standard design flow. It is demonstrated in 0.13 μm complementary metal-oxide-semiconductor (CMOS) technology with the supply voltage of 300 mV. 展开更多

To construct and express the fusion protein Stx2B-IntiminC300 of EHEC O157 : H7, and to further investigate its immunoprophylactic potential, the gene of Stx2B (stx2b) from EHEC O157:H7 chromosome was cloned into pMD18-T vector. Thereafter, the amplified gene was cloned into prokary- otic expression plasmid pET-28a ( + )-eaeC300, which was constructed previously. The recombinant pasmid pET-28a( + )-stx2b-eaeC300 was transformed into E. coli BL21 (DE3). After inducement, the protein Stx2B-IntiminC300 was successfully expressed and analyzed with sodium dodecyl sulfate polyacrylamide gel electrophoresis (SDS-PAGE), Western blotting and N-terminal amino acid residual sequencing. To evaluate its immunoprophylactic potential, it was primarily purified by ion-exchange chromatography and injected into 30 BALB/c mice with AI(OH)3 in the subscapular region. Ten days after the last booster vaccination, 20 mice were attacked with EHEC O157:H7 lysate and the protective efficacy was observed. In the present study, the gene of Stx2B-intiminC300 was successfully cloned into pET-28a ( + ) vector. The results of SDS-PAGE and Western blotting assay showed that the fusion protein was successfully expressed in the inclusion body form, accounting for 25 % of total expression products, and its molecular weight was about 43 kDa. The result of the N-terminal amino acid residual sequencing showed that it was identical to that of the molecular designed. The purity was about 75 % after primary purification. Animal tests revealed that the fusion protein Stx2B-intiminC300 has elicited high titer of protective antibody relatively. These results demonstrate that the fusion protein Stx2B-IntiminC300 is successfully expressed in prokaryotic expression system and shows certain immunoprophylactic potential. 展开更多

BACKGROUND Real-time shear wave elastography(SWE)is a non-invasive imaging technique used to measure tissue stiffness by generating and tracking shear waves in real time.This advanced ultrasound-based method provides quantitative information regarding tissue elasticity,offering valuable insights into the mechanical properties of biological tissues.However,the application of real-time SWE in the musculoskeletal system and sports medicine has not been extensively studied.AIM To explore the practical value of real-time SWE for assessing Achilles tendon hardness in older adults.METHODS A total of 60 participants were enrolled in the present study,and differences in the elastic moduli of the bilateral Achilles tendons were compared among the following categories:(1)Age:55-60,60-65,and 65-70-years-old;(2)Sex:Male and female;(3)Laterality:Left and right sides;(4)Tendon state:Relaxed and tense state;and(5)Tendon segment:Proximal,middle,and distal.RESULTS There were no significant differences in the elastic moduli of the bilateral Achilles tendons when comparing by age or sex(P>0.05).There were,however,significant differences when comparing by tendon side,state,or segment(P<0.05).CONCLUSION Real-time SWE plays a significant role compared to other examination methods in the evaluation of Achilles tendon hardness in older adults. 展开更多

红外相机技术在野生动物调查研究中得到广泛应用,其发展和普及为中国自然保护地生物多样性保护带来了诸多机会。为进一步推广该技术在我国自然保护地野生动物监测中的应用,中国林业科学研究院森林生态环境与保护研究所在自然保护区生物... 红外相机技术在野生动物调查研究中得到广泛应用,其发展和普及为中国自然保护地生物多样性保护带来了诸多机会。为进一步推广该技术在我国自然保护地野生动物监测中的应用,中国林业科学研究院森林生态环境与保护研究所在自然保护区生物标本资源共享子平台增设野生动物红外相机数据库专栏,并通过门户网站"中国自然保护区生物标本资源共享平台"(http://gffzz11c3e935e38f46c1hcbqpvpq5kn606nuo.ffgz.tsg.suse.edu.cn/)对外发布,向公众开放,可以随时查阅、下载信息。本文重点介绍了该平台的野生动物红外相机数据库建设进展,包括所监测的自然保护区、监测方案、数据规范存储、标准化分析、成果介绍、工作计划等内容。2010–2019年间,该平台使用红外相机调查技术在全国13个不同类型的保护地开展兽类和鸟类资源调查,累计27.25万个有效工作日,共拍摄到8.41万张独立图像,经鉴定有80种野生兽类和200种野生鸟类,并利用这些数据对野生动物行为、稀有物种探测、人为干扰,以及气候变化影响等方面进行研究,取得了重要的阶段性成果。下一步,子平台牵头单位将筹建自然保护地红外相机数据共享平台,制定红外相机调查设计、监测技术、数据格式等统一标准化方案,逐步完善我国自然保护地野生动物红外相机监测网络。 展开更多
